I try to keep my designs on the simpler side by making them with fewer individual pieces by creating patterns that use one piece of leather to make the front, back, sides and top. This results in less usable material from a given side of leather but results in less stress joints and a clean overall look. Everything I make is hand stitched using the “saddle stitch” technique with my preference of using a thread that contrast the leather and reserving the use of rivets for high stress locations only.
